
?
03.09.2018
01:50:11
ммм, да, это в копилку докера
посоветовали тож ovirt, но у людей там 2000 вм и 5 кластеров, ггг
я сомневаюсь, что у меня в скором времени будет больше 2 почтовых и webdav плюс макс 250 клиентских
да, согласен, я тут как раз читал про новый проксмокс и овирт, пм выглядит проще :)

Google

?
03.09.2018
02:10:20
ну, да, еще у меня лет 5 опыта регулярного посматривания в пм, а овирт я даже погонять не ставил

Эдуард
03.09.2018
02:10:46
Допустим докер, но точно не надо сворм. Пили кубас)

?
03.09.2018
02:11:08
го холивар!)
jkjk

Эдуард
03.09.2018
02:24:18
И я один, ничего, живёт всё моё.
Сворм будет падать, гарантирую. Например мастера будут проёбывать всю метадату.
Кубер + цепх идеальный вариант, даже на виртуалках у меня живёт (до). Но цепх надо уметь готовить, посему у меня пока персист в кубере не водится для боя.

Dmitry
03.09.2018
02:39:54

Sergey
03.09.2018
03:25:17
Обычно так и работаем. 10 разрабов, 10 нод и один девопс собирает для всего этого кубер+половину имеджей и деплой по чартам

Dmitry
03.09.2018
03:34:34
Мне реально интересно. Потому что в сценарии «Виртуалки hetzner” тот же heketi не заработал когда один блок девайс. А с байнд папкой не хочет работать

Sergey
03.09.2018
03:36:05

Dmitry
03.09.2018
03:36:20
Ну и как стабильность? Какие нагрузки ?
С одним девопсом как то стремно

Google

?
03.09.2018
03:37:06
это ровно на 1 больше, чем у нас :D

Sergey
03.09.2018
03:37:40
а че ему, написал все, пришел к конечному варианту, и ливать в контору со строчкой "перевел провект на k8s"))
ну несколько месяцев точно уйдет если кубер с нуля изучать
у нас так чувак поработал полгодика и ушел в МРГ

?
03.09.2018
03:39:05
мрг?

Dmitry
03.09.2018
03:39:09
Тут кубер, цеф
Да ещё проксмокс
3 фундаментальные софтины не по бизнесу. Хз
Хорошая тема для подкаста )))

Sergey
03.09.2018
03:40:01
нуачо, выкат виртуалок по шаблонам ролями ансибла
потом на это все разлив кубера
потом чартами проект
готово

Dmitry
03.09.2018
03:40:29
Ну а если че падает?

Sergey
03.09.2018
03:40:44
падает где?)

Dmitry
03.09.2018
03:41:02
Где-то

Sergey
03.09.2018
03:41:15
ну, дисковая подсистема точно не падает:)
главная запара которая не решена еще это динамические поды

Dmitry
03.09.2018
03:41:35
падает где?)
Имхо риски прям видны, играем с огнём. Какой нагруз-то?
В моем случае IoT проект, с тысячами реальных девайсов, каждый под $800, я бы не стал так рисковать. Я отсюда исхожу

Sergey
03.09.2018
03:43:03
странно описывать нагруз, потому что то в каждом проекте своя логика приложений, свои сервисы, и для одних нагрузка будет одной, для других другой

Google

Dmitry
03.09.2018
03:43:27
Ну наверное общая стадия компании интересует
И порядок рисков

Sergey
03.09.2018
03:43:57
а в том случае был межбанковский сервис
или как его называют

Dmitry
03.09.2018
03:44:24
Для себя я пилю докер сворм, на 3х хетцнерах. Быстро и сердито.
Но да. Правильной готовке кубера я только за

Sergey
03.09.2018
03:45:59
ну типа банк+банк+банк а между ними хаб с международными переводами

Dmitry
03.09.2018
03:46:55
А какие знание разрабам нужно иметь? Допустим деплой фейлится

Эдуард
03.09.2018
03:47:38

?
03.09.2018
03:47:52

Sergey
03.09.2018
03:47:59
scale?
не, не так выразился
я про шару

Dmitry
03.09.2018
03:48:13

Эдуард
03.09.2018
03:48:24

Dmitry
03.09.2018
03:48:28

Эдуард
03.09.2018
03:48:28
pvc?

Sergey
03.09.2018
03:48:33

?
03.09.2018
03:48:44
Там 400-800
основная часть цены это датчики, я так понимаю?

Эдуард
03.09.2018
03:48:47
так есть же автопровижн

Sergey
03.09.2018
03:48:49
или в 1.11 пофиксили?

Dmitry
03.09.2018
03:49:04

Google

?
03.09.2018
03:49:17

Dmitry
03.09.2018
03:49:22

?
03.09.2018
03:49:23
или нда
давай :)

Sergey
03.09.2018
03:49:27
так есть же автопровижн
давай разберемся, что мы нигде не запутались
нужна динамически расширяемая файловая хранилка типа ondemand

Dmitry
03.09.2018
03:49:36
Meetflo.com
m

Эдуард
03.09.2018
03:49:43

?
03.09.2018
03:49:52

Dmitry
03.09.2018
03:50:11
Meetflo.com
Ну оно в продакшене давно. Нда на внутренние технологии само собой

Sergey
03.09.2018
03:51:21
cephfs
а, это то да, но слишком геморно подымать для маленькой шары чет такое на цефе
крч плюнули, пока в nfs торчит, все равно запросы к шаре не сильно часто идут
?

Эдуард
03.09.2018
03:51:36

Dmitry
03.09.2018
03:52:52
Так то нужен отдельно кто за кубер отвечает полностью и ещё один девопс по остальным делам. Дофига рисков иначе имхо

Sergey
03.09.2018
03:53:00
просто когда еще 1.9 был, подумали подумали
"а давай нфс тада"))
в любом случае, мне вродь зашло
получилось как бы gitlab pipelines+Helm charts+Dapp(вместо дефолт докера)
потому что фронт собирается час:))))

Dmitry
03.09.2018
03:55:01
Так разрабы должны понимать helm или абстрагированы?

Google

Sergey
03.09.2018
03:57:54
по сути должны, вся дока по куберу\всем развертываниям\базовой настройке написана
но прод только для девопса

Валерий
03.09.2018
03:58:25
Разрабы ничего делать не должны, они пишут код

Sergey
03.09.2018
03:58:40
правило девопс №1
никогда не пускать разрабов на прод
на любом проекте?

Валерий
03.09.2018
03:59:30
И даже если код написан через жопу, виноват всё равно админ

Dmitry
03.09.2018
03:59:59

Sergey
03.09.2018
04:00:51

Валерий
03.09.2018
04:01:07
и отвечать за говнокод не им

Sergey
03.09.2018
04:06:57
ну тут в целом таки место для обсуждения, может в какой то степени можно
просто смотря какие разработчики, там же как, чуть чуть им руки развязал, они ченить допилят, потом хоба у тебя оверхед вырос на ресурсы, появились дисконнекты межсервисные, и по накатанной
а так да, быть частью проекта, обращаться к разрабам если че за помощью, это да, на коллаборации девопс и строится, тут скорее дело в безопасности конечного результата

Dmitry
03.09.2018
04:15:15
Но вообще мне живо интересна масштабируемость людей

Sergey
03.09.2018
04:15:26
я не говорю ограничивать их совсем, я скорее имел ввиду "доступ к деплою на прод"

Dmitry
03.09.2018
04:16:00
Как сделать так чтобы бесконечному числу разрабов было хорошо.

Sergey
03.09.2018
04:16:09
это как всегда:)
я грю, сколько у вас фпм нагруженный будет жрать? мы не знаем
тогда почему на перфе он жрет 4гб
а на проде 12?)